MONROE, N.C. (QUEEN CITY NEWS) -- A Union County mother is holding her son close, after the 5-year-old boy walked out of school without anyone noticing.  Earlier this week, a good Samaritan picked him up off the side of a busy road and took him home.  When Julia Blackman drops her kids off at Prospect Elementary School south of Monroe, she expects someone to watch over them and keep them safe.
